46 AWLFIELD AVENUE, LONDON
Reg Number: 10806734
Date of Inc: July 06, 2017
38 AWLFIELD AVENUE, LONDON
Reg Number: 12687959
Date of Inc: January 01, 1970
Reg Number: 12948388
Reg Number: 11831879
Reg Number: 12748857
Reg Number: 11885944